Immigrants from Senegal vs Ghanaian Associate's Degree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 90,125,204 people shows a slight neg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Senegal and percentage of population with at least associate's degree education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.052 and weighted average of 45.2%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 190,686,281 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Ghanaians and percentage of population with at least associate's degree education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.020 and weighted average of 45.8%, a difference of 1.4%.
